What you can eat here
Pulled from Gluto's celiac safety report for this location.
✅ Reported safe options
- Chicken pho is explicitly mentioned as gluten-free in at least one customer report.
- Veggie summer rolls are explicitly mentioned as gluten-free in the same report.
- The general pattern across many reviews is that most of the menu is gluten-free, with only a small number of items containing gluten and clearly marked as such.
⚠️ Risks & cross-contamination
- There are rare negative reports about kitchen practices, including mentions of staff behavior in specific instances. Such anecdotes are not representative of the majority of recent experiences, which are overwhelmingly positive.
- A couple of items are sometimes identified as not gluten-free, with clear labeling in many cases. Always confirm with staff about any dish you’re considering, particularly items that might be fried or prepared in shared equipment.
- Overall, cross-contamination risk appears to be mitigated by staff training, menu labeling, and ongoing Coeliac UK accreditation signals in the evidence pool.
